Human Body Detectives Merrin and Pearl are at it again.

Their magical ability to jump into people's bodies and explore their systems (digestive, skeletal, nervous ( June 2014), circulatory, and immune) combines science with their fun adventures to help kids understand their anatomy and how their bodies work.

In The Lucky Escape, Merrin and Pearl explore their little brother, Robbie's, digestive system because they have to get a penny that he swallowed! Along the way, they slide down his esophagus, bump in to gas bubbles, and learn up close about the functions of the stomach and intestines, and so much more.
In the end, they not only get the penny, but they also get a firsthand lesson on the functions of the digestive system.
Ideal for both the home and the classroom, these beautifully illustrated books offer activity pages as well as a glossary of terms and information about the best foods kids can eat to keep their bodies healthy. A curriculum for teachers is also available for each book. The Human Body Detectives series offers science with a twist--an accessible lesson about the human body presented in a fun, relatable way that kids will love.
Each Human Body Detective book can stand alone as well as be read as part of the series.
The Lucky Escape is one of five stories featured in the Human Body Detectives series, along with Battle with the Bugs, A Heart Pumping Adventure, Osteoblasts to the Rescue, and Brainiacs ( summer 2014).
